Abstract

The objective of this pilot malacological survey was to identify the snail intermediate hosts for   in endemic rural and semi-urban areas of Gabon. Snails were collected, morphologically identified, and tested for infection by cercarial shedding. Released cercariae were morphologically identified using low-power light microscopy. A total of six species of snails were collected throughout the study area, with  , , and spp. being the most predominant species collected.
